Notes

General Note
"This is an abridged edition of Dr. Seuss's Sleep Book, originally published in hardcover in the U.S. by Random House Children's Books in 1962."--P. 4 of cover.
Description
An interactive, touch-and-feel story invites toddlers to explore the soft beds, bellies and pillows of iconic sleepy characters, in an edition published to commemorate the 50th anniversary of the classic, Dr. Seuss's Sleep Book. On board pages.
